The Science of Superman
We are all very excited by the new Superman movie and indeed Superdog!! But, have you ever thought about the science of Superman ?
Superman was born on the planet Krypton and was sent to Earth in a rocket built by his father Jor-el, who was a scientist and predicted that Krypton was going to explode. Why this was going to happen is never fully explained and there’s no natural reason that could explain this. Maybe Krypton’s orbit around its sun had begun to decline and it was reaching what is know as the Roche Limit, a point about 2.4 times higher than the radius of the central body (in this case the star) at which point gravity tears the orbiting body (in this case Krypton) apart.
We are told that Krypton orbits a red star. The closest such star is Gacrux, the third-brightest star in the southern constellation of Crux, the Southern Cross. It is 88 light years [or 528 trillion miles] away. This means even travelling as fast as he was, Superman in a rocket from Krypton would take 1.2 million years to reach Earth !!
His super powers we are told come from the effect of a yellow sun on a person born under a re sun and also from the lighter gravitational pull of the Earth, which helps him to fly. We know that the light of a red sun has a very different electromagnetic profile from that of a yellow sun. The main effect would be on plants, which would be a different colour [red or yellow or dusky white] to make the best use of the available light. Humans and animals on Earth have adapted to the relatively high ultraviolet output of a yellow sun. Superman, born under a lower UV red sun would have not such protection and would probably blister and burn.
Also life in a place with lighter gravity would not be easy, Superman might feel more buoyant but coming from a place where he adapted to a higher gravity feel, over time his bones would decalcify and his joints and muscles would degenerate and atrophy.
